Griha Jyoti Yojana: How to apply through mobile app? See 5 steps here

The verification process for the Karnataka government’s ambitious ‘Griha Jyothi’ scheme has now begun through a new app, and a video informing the public about this has gone viral on social media.

Customers who are availing the benefits of the Gruha Jyothi scheme can verify their details through the following steps. There are a total of 5 steps. Step 1: Verification of customer details

First open the Gruha Jyothi App on your mobile.

Select your electricity supply company (ESCOM – for example: HESCOM, BESCOM etc.).

Then enter your customer account number (Account ID) and click on ‘Get details’.

Now the customer name and address details will appear on the screen. If these are correct, click ‘Yes’ and continue.

Step 2: Mobile and Aadhaar e-KYC verification

Mobile verification: Enter your new mobile number. Verify the mobile number by entering the OTP received on that number.

Relationship Details: Select whether you are the owner or the tenant of the house.

Aadhaar e-KYC: Enter your Aadhaar number, agree to the terms and conditions and generate an OTP. Complete the Aadhaar verification by entering the OTP sent to the mobile number linked to Aadhaar.

Then select your district, taluk and assembly constituency correctly.

Step 3: Voter ID and Ration Card Details

Select the appropriate option according to your ration card type (APL/BPL).

Mark ‘Yes’ for whether you are a registered voter of Karnataka.

Enter your full name and EPIC number as it appears on your Voter ID.

Upload a clear photo of the front and back side of your Voter ID using your camera.

Step 4: Select Income Tax, Profession and Category

Select ‘Yes’ if you are an Income Tax payer, otherwise select ‘No’. (If you are a Taxpayer, you will need to upload PAN card details and photo).

Select your profession (eg: Farmer, Self-Employed, Teacher etc.).

Select your social category (SC, ST, OBC, Minority, Others).

Note: If you select ‘ST’ or a specific category, it is mandatory to enter your RD certificate number. This is not required for OBC or other categories.

Step 5: Upload Photo and Final Submission

Finally, click and upload the live photo of the applicant.

Read the Self-Declaration Rules carefully and tick the check box to confirm that it is correct.

Make sure that all the details are correct and finally click on the ‘Submit Application’ button.

As soon as these steps are completed, a message will appear on the screen stating that the registration has been successfully submitted. After reviewing your application, you will be informed about the next steps.
